Understanding Robot Mops
Robot mops are autonomous machines that clean up floorings by using a mix of sensors, cameras, and mopping technology. They are configured to navigate areas effectively while preserving a tidy environment. robot cleaner vacuum and mop offer a dual-functionality, cleaning both dry and wet surfaces, hence making them versatile home appliances for different floor types.
Secret Features of Robot Mops
To appreciate the improvements in robot mop innovation, it's necessary to understand the key functions that distinguish them from conventional cleaning methods:
- Automated Navigation: Most robot mops are geared up with sophisticated sensors that help them map the layout of a room, avoiding obstacles and avoiding falls.
- Several Cleaning Modes: Many models allow users to choose various cleaning modes depending on the level of dirt and kind of floor covering (e.g., hardwood, tile).
- Arranging Options: Users can set up cleaning sessions even when they are not at home, making sure a consistently clean home.
- Smart Connectivity: Some gadgets link to smartphone apps or clever home systems, permitting remote control and monitoring.
- Self-Emptying: Premium designs can empty their unclean water reservoir immediately, minimizing upkeep for users.

Kinds Of Robot Mops Available in the UK
As the market for robotic cleaning devices grows, so does the diversity of choices. The following is an overview of the most typical types available in the UK:
Type
Description
Hybrid Robot Mops
Combine vacuuming and mopping functions in one system.
Devoted Robot Mops
Particularly developed for damp mopping, typically with improved scrubbing capabilities.
Self-Emptying Models
Instantly deal with dirty water, lowering the requirement for regular upkeep.
Smart Models
Geared up with innovative software and sensors allowing connectivity with clever home systems for remote control.
Aspects to Consider When Purchasing a Robot Mop
When considering which robot mop to buy, potential purchasers should think about several essential factors to guarantee they buy the most appropriate model for their needs:
- Floor Type: Consider the surface area materials in your home. Some designs work much better on specific surface areas while offering limited effectiveness on others.
- Battery Life: The duration a robot mop operates on one charge will impact how large of an area it can clean.
- Water Capacity: Look for designs with bigger water tanks for more prolonged cleaning sessions without regular refills.
- Noise Level: Some units run quietly, which can be vital for homes with animals or little kids.
- Maintenance Requirements: Understand what regular maintenance jobs are needed and how easy it will be to perform them.
Popular Robot Mop Brands in the UK
As the market expands, numerous brands have established themselves as leaders in the robot mop category. Significant brands include:
- iRobot: Known for the Roomba series, they likewise offer the Braava line particularly for mopping.
- Roborock: Offers innovative styles with strong suction and mopping capabilities, and exceptional app connection.
- Ecovacs: Features designs with strong wet cleaning capabilities and clever home combination.
- Shark: While known for its vacuum cleaners, Shark has gotten in the robotic space with easy to use mop models offering flexible functions.

FREQUENTLY ASKED QUESTION
1. Are robot mops ideal for all floor types?The majority of robot mops are designed to work well on tough floorings such as wood, tile, and laminate. However, it's essential to examine the manufacturer's specifications to ensure compatibility.
2. How often should I utilize my robot mop?This depends upon the level of foot traffic and mess in your house. For hectic households, daily operation may be helpful, while less hectic environments might require just weekly cleans up.
3. Can I control my robot mop with a smartphone?Numerous modern robot mops come equipped with wise connection functions, allowing users to control and schedule cleaning by means of a smart device app.
4. What maintenance do robot mops require?Routine upkeep includes clearing the water tank, cleaning filters, and making sure sensing units are devoid of debris. Refer to the item handbook for specific guidelines.
5. Do robot mops replace traditional mopping entirely?While robot mops work for light cleaning and maintenance, they may not totally replace conventional mopping for deep cleans in larger or greatly stained locations.
